/* CSS Document */
.is-mainbox {
    margin: 0 auto;
    width: 1000px;
}
.is-mainnr {
    padding-top: 0;
}
.is-line {
    background: none repeat scroll 0 0 #fff;
    border: 1px solid #ddd;
}
.is-240 {
    background: none repeat scroll 0 0 #fbfbfb;
    width: 210px;
}
.is-lititle {
    background: url("imageslisttitle.gif") repeat-x scroll center top;
    color: #fff;
    font-size: 20px;
    font-weight: bold;
    height: 45px;
    line-height: 38px;
    padding-left:15px;
	color:#0073d0;
}
.is-leftnav {
    border-top: 0 none;
    height: auto !important;
    min-height: 320px;
    padding: 5px 4px;
}
.is-leftnav h1 {
    font-size: 14px;
    height: 26px;
    line-height: 26px;
    margin: 5px 10px;
}
.is-leftnav h1 a {
    background: url("imageslisth1bg.gif") no-repeat scroll left top ;
    display: block;
    padding-left: 30px;
	margin: 5px 0;
	font-weight: normal;
}
.is-leftnav h1 a.hover {
    background: url("imageslisth1bg.gif") no-repeat scroll left bottom;
    color: #fff;
	margin: 5px 0;
}
.is-leftnav h1 a:hover {
    background: url("imageslisth1bg.gif") no-repeat scroll left bottom ;
    color: #fff;
    text-decoration: none;
}
.is-leftnav h2 {
    font-size: 12px;
    height: 26px;
    line-height: 26px;
    margin: 5px auto;
	font-weight:normal;
    padding-left: 15px;
    width: 175px;
    overflow: hidden;
}
.is-leftnav h2 a{color:#666;}
.is-788 {
    width: 788px;
}
.bot10 {
    margin-bottom: 10px;
}
.is-postion {
    background: url("imageslistposbg.gif") repeat-x scroll center top ;
    color: #666;
    height: 39px;
    line-height: 39px;
    padding: 0 22px;
	overflow:hidden;
}
.is-postion a {
    color: #666;
    margin: 0 4px;
}
.is-postion a:hover {
    color: #20871b;
}
.is-posbg {
    background: url("imageslisthome.gif") no-repeat scroll left center;
    height: 36px;
    line-height: 36px;
    padding-left: 24px;
	float:left;
}
.is-rightnr {
    height: auto !important;
    min-height: 500px;
    padding-bottom: 20px;
	overflow:hidden;
}
.is-listnews {
    padding: 9px 10px;
}
.is-listnews li {
    border-bottom: 1px dashed #ddd;
    font-size: 14px;
    height: 30px;
    line-height: 30px;
    list-style: none outside none;
}
.is-listnews li {
    color: #333;
}
.is-listnews li span {
    color: #333;
    float: right;
}
.is-listnews li a {
    background: url("imageslistarr.gif") no-repeat scroll left center;
    padding-left: 8px;
}
.is-contentbox {
    clear: both;
    height: auto !important;
    min-height: 500px;
    padding: 20px 20px 0;
}
.is-newstitle {
    color: #1b7dc6;
    font-family: "微软雅黑";
    font-size: 26px;
    line-height: 40px;
    padding-bottom: 8px;
    text-align: center;
}
.is-info {
    background: none repeat scroll 0 0 #fafafa;
    border-bottom: 1px solid #ddd;
    border-top: 1px solid #ddd;
    color: #888;
    height: 36px;
    text-align: center;
}
.is-info .is-leftinfo span {
    line-height: 36px;
    padding: 0 11px;
}
#bdshare {
    float: left;
    font-size: 12px;
    padding-bottom: 2px;
    padding-left: 30px;
    text-align: left !important;
    z-index: 999999;
}
.is-newscontnet {
    color: #333;
    font-size: 14px;
    height: auto;
    line-height: 200%;
    min-height: 400px;
    padding: 25px 15px;
}
.is-newscontnet p {
    color: #000;
    font-family: "宋体",Tahoma;
    line-height: 200%;
}
.is-tips {
    background: url("imageslisttipbg.gif") no-repeat scroll left center);
    color: #979797;
    font-size: 12px;
    height: 50px;
    line-height: 50px;
    padding-left: 54px;
}
.is-tips span {
    color: #979797;
    margin-right: 12px;
}
.is-tipsr {
    float: right;
    padding-right: 10px;
}
.is-tipsr a {
    border: 1px solid #ddd;
    color: #888;
    margin: 0 0 0 5px;
    padding: 3px 7px;
}
.is-nlist {
    color: #333;
    line-height: 46px;
}
.is-nlist a {
    color: #333;
}
.bgfff {
    background: none repeat scroll 0 0 #fff;
}
.is-feednr {
    height: auto !important;
    min-height: 400px;
}
.is-search-jl {
    font-size: 14px;
    font-weight: bold;
    height: 40px;
    line-height: 20px;
}
.is-search-list {
    height: auto;
    min-height: 550px;
}
.is-search-list ul li {
    border-bottom: 1px dashed #dddddd;
    color: #999999;
    height: auto;
    line-height: 30px;
    list-style: none outside none;
    margin-bottom: 5px;
    padding-bottom: 5px;
    padding-left: 21px;
}
.is-search-list ul li  span{
    float:right;
}
.is-listpic {
    padding: 20px 0 0 20px;
}
.is-listpic li {
    display: inline;
    float: left;
    height: 184px;
    padding: 0 15px;
    width: 204px;
}
.is-listpic li img {
    border: 1px solid #dddddd;
    height: 150px;
    padding: 2px;
    width: 200px;
}
.is-listpic li div {
    font-size: 14px;
    height: 44px;
    line-height: 32px;
    text-align: center;
}

.photoMHD .photoNews {
    margin: 0 auto;
    min-height: 500px;
    padding: 16px 0 26px;
    width: 982px;
}
.photoMHD .photoNews .picDiv {
    position: relative;
    text-align: center;
}
.wrap_text {
    float: left;
    width: 700px;
    margin-top: -10px;
}
.wrap_text p.text_con {
    color: #999;
}
.wrap_text p.text_con a {
    color: #a16b00;
}
.zy p {
    display: inline;
    float: left;
    line-height: 20px;
    margin-left: 15px;
    padding-bottom: 6px;
    text-align: left;
    width: 700px;
}
.photoMHD .photoList {
    margin: 0 auto;
    width: 926px;
}
.photoMHD .photoList a {
    color: #666;
}
.photoMHD .photoList a:hover {
    color: #999;
}
.sharebox {
    border-bottom: 1px solid #c1c1c1;
    clear: both;
    height: 30px;
    line-height: 30px;
    padding: 0 0 0 20px;
}
.photoMHD .zy {
    margin: 11px auto 0;
    width: 950px;
}
.photoMHD {
    margin: 0 auto;
    width: 982px;
}
.keywords {
    color: #666;
}
.keywords a:link, .keywords a:visited, .keywords a:active {
    color: #666;
}
.is-zixun{ width:119px; height:31px; line-height:31px; background:url("imageslistjl_bg.gif") no-repeat; padding-left:33px; float:right;margin-top:5px;}
.is-zixun a{ color:#3787cd;}
.is-zixun a:hover{ color:#414344;}

.is-cont1{ height:auto; overflow:hidden; border-top:1px solid #e1e1e1; width:100%; margin-top:6px;}
.is-cont1 .is-thead{ height:30px; width:100%; border-bottom:1px solid #e1e1e1; background:#f6f6f6;}
.is-thead span{ display:inline-block; height:30px; line-height:30px; width:70px; border-right:1px solid #e1e1e1; text-align:center;}
.is-thead span.title1{ width:130px;}
.is-thead span.title2{ width:400px;}
.is-thead span.last{border-right:none;}
.is-tbody{ width:100%; height:auto; overflow:hidden; line-height:auto; position:relative; border-bottom:1px solid #e1e1e1;}
.is-tbody .is-title{ position:absolute; left:40px; top:50%; margin-top:-7px;}
.is-tbody .is-right{ float:right; width:647px;border-left:1px solid #e1e1e1;}
.is-tbody .is-right ul li{ height:30px; line-height:30px; padding-left:26px;}
.is-tbody .is-right ul li.hover{ background:#f5f5f5;}
.is-tbody .is-right ul li span{ width:20px; height:19px; display:inline-block; margin-top:6px; float:right; cursor:pointer;}
.is-tbody .is-right ul li span.licon1{background:url("imageslistlist_icons.gif") no-repeat 0 0; margin-right:58px;}
.is-tbody .is-right ul li span.licon2{background:url("imageslistlist_icons.gif") no-repeat -76px 0; margin-right:64px;}
.is-tbody .is-right ul li span.licon3{background:url("imageslistlist_icons.gif") no-repeat -145px 0; margin-right:30px;}

.is-content1 .is-glq {
    background: none repeat scroll 0 0 #fff;
    float: left;
    height: 271px;
    overflow: hidden;
    position: relative;
    width:778px;
}
.is-glq .is-tabs{background: url("imagesbox_title_bg.gif") repeat-x;}


/* 翻页样式 */
#page_list {
    line-height: 20px;
    text-align: right;
    padding: 10px;
    font-size: 14px;
    font-family:'Arial';
}
#page_list .page {
    border: 1px solid #e0e0e0;
    -webkit-border-radius: 3px;
    -moz-border-radius: 3px;
    border-radius: 3px;
    color: #868585;
    text-decoration: none;
    margin-right: 4px;
    margin-left: 4px;
    padding-top: 4px;
    padding-right: 8px;
    padding-bottom: 4px;
    padding-left: 8px;
}
#page_list .page:hover {
    border: 1px solid #e0e0e0;
    background-color: #f1f1f1;
    color: #868585;
}
#page_list a {
    text-decoration: none;
}
#page_list a:hover {
    color: #0000FF;
}
#page_list .currentpage {
    border: 1px solid #e0e0e0;
    -webkit-border-radius: 3px;
    -moz-border-radius: 3px;
    border-radius: 3px;
    background-color: #f1f1f1;
    color: #868585;
    text-decoration: none;
    margin-right: 4px;
    margin-left: 4px;
    padding-top: 4px;
    padding-right: 8px;
    padding-bottom: 4px;
    padding-left: 8px;
}
#page_list .direct {
    margin-left: 20px;
    padding: 5px 40px 5px 8px;
}

#page_list .direct input{
    color: #666;
    padding: 2px 2px;
    border: 1px solid #ddd;
    margin: 0px 3px;
    width: 30px;
    position: absolute;
    line-height: 15px;
    height: 15px;
}
#page_list .determine {
    color: #666;
    padding: 5px 8px;
    border: 1px solid #ddd;
    margin: 0 3px;
}
#page_list .determine:hover{
	background: #e50000;
    color: #fff;
    text-decoration: none;
    border: 1px solid #e50000;
}
/* 文件下载列表 */
.is-downlist ul li{padding-left: 10px;height:26px; line-height:26px;background:url(imageslibg.gif) left 10px no-repeat; }

/* feedback 页面 */
.is-feednr{}
table.is-feedback td{vertical-align:middle;font-size:14px; font-family:"微软雅黑"; background-color:#ffffff;padding: 4px 10px;}
table.is-feedback{ border-spacing:1px; border-collapse:separate; }
.is-feedback,.is-feedbox{ margin-bottom:15px; marign:0 18% 25px 18%;}
.is-feedback li{ height:36px; line-height:36px; font-size:14px; font-family:"微软雅黑";}
.is-feedbox li{  min-height:35px; height:auto !important;   height:35px; padding:0 0 10px 0; line-height:35px; font-size:14px; font-family:"微软雅黑"; zoom:1; clear:both;}
.is-feedbox li label,.is-feedbox li input,.is-feedbox li img{ float:left;}
.is-feedbox li img{ margin-right:10px;}
.is-feedbox li label{
	width:90px;
	/* [disabled]display:block; */
}
li.is-bdnr{ height:auto;line-height:22px; padding-bottom:8px;}

.is-feedbox li input{    background: #fff;
    position: relative;
    line-height: 1.5em;
    border: 1px solid #dddddd;
    padding: 6px;
    color: #a7b2b8;
    border-radius: 4px;
    -moz-border-radius: 4px;
    -webkit-border-radius: 4px;
	
}
.is-feedbox li textarea {
    background: #fff;
    position: relative;
    line-height: 1.5em;
    border: 1px solid #dddddd;
    padding: 6px;
    color: #a7b2b8;
    border-radius: 4px;
    -moz-border-radius: 4px;
    -webkit-border-radius: 4px;
    overflow: auto;
    resize: none;
	
}
.is-feedbox input.button{    background: #313233;
    display: inline-block;
    position: relative;
    height: 33px;
    overflow: hidden;
    margin: 18px 2% 2px 0;
    padding: 0 15px 0 15px;
    vertical-align: top;
    line-height: 34px;
    font-family: 'Droid Sans', sans-serif;
    font-size: 12px;
    font-weight: 700;
    text-transform: uppercase;
    text-decoration: none;
    color: #fff;
    border: none;
    border-radius: 5px;
    -moz-border-radius: 5px;
    -webkit-border-radius: 5px;
	cursor:pointer;
}
.is-feedbox input.button:hover {
    background: #00b2d7;
    color: #fff;
}

.is-feedbacklist{ margin:10px 0;}

.is-feedbacklist li{ padding:10px 0; border-bottom:1px solid #ddd;  line-height:20px;}
.is-feedbacktitle{  background:#f1f1f1; color:#333; border-top:1px solid #ddd; border-bottom:1px solid #ddd;}
.is-feedbacktitle .is-border{ padding:5px 10px; border-top:1px solid #fff; border-bottom:1px solid #fff; color:#333;}
.is-feedbacktitle .right{ float:right;}
.is-feedbacktitle .left{ float:left;}
.is-feedbacktitle .is-border span{ display:block;}
.is-bold{ font-weight:bold; color:#f60;}

.is-feedbackcontent{  color:#333; padding:5px 10px;   line-height:20px;}
.is-hftitme{ text-align:right; border-top:1px dashed #ddd; padding:8px 0 0 0; }
.is-sitemap{ padding:25px 15px; min-height:500px;}
.is-sitemap ul li{ height:auto; line-height:30px; background: url(imageslibg.jpg) left 10px no-repeat;  margin-bottom:5px; border-bottom:1px dashed #dddddd;  padding:0 0 8px 20px;}
.is-sitemap ul li h2{ font-size:14px; padding:0 0 8px 0;}
.is-sitemap ul li a{padding-left:10px;height: 24px;line-height: 24px;background: url(imagesarr.png) left center no-repeat; margin-right:10px;}
.is-sitemap ul li h2 a{ padding:0; background:none;}



.h32{ background:url(imageshbg.gif) repeat-x; height:32px; line-height:29px; border:#ddd 1px solid; border-bottom:none; padding:0 0 0 13px;}
.h32 a{ float:right; color:#666;}
.h32 span{ font-size:14px; font-weight:bold; color:#004986; background:url(imageslibg1.gif) no-repeat left center; padding-left:15px;}    
.is-listul{ margin:7px 25px 30px 25px;}
.is-listul li span{ float:right;}
.is-listul li{ height:28px; line-height:28px; background:url(imagesarr2.gif) no-repeat left center; padding-left:8px;font-size: 14px;}
.is-listul li a{ color:#4e4e4e;font-size: 14px;}
.is-listul li span{ color:#949494}
